 Making 1/12 Scale Wicker Furniture for the Dolls' House by Sheila Smith, It takes only a few pages to lay out the tools and weaving techniques, which primarily involve plaiting cotton around wire strands. Twenty-five breathtaking projects, shown in color photos, include a dining room table and chairs; bed and blanket box; bathroom shelf; kitchen storage baskets; and much more. From a baby's cradle to a "chaise longue, each item is a small masterpiece.
Furniture - Furniture is the collective term for the movable objects which support the human body (seating furniture and beds), provide storage, and hold objects on horizontal surfaces above the ground. Storage furniture is used to hold or contain smaller objects such as clothes, tools, books, and household goods. Cabinet (furniture) - A cabinet is a usually oblong piece of furniture, often attached to a wall and made of wood, used throughout the world for the storage of clothes or other miscellaneous items. Usually have a pair of doors on the front, occasionally with a lock. Chest (furniture) - A chest is one of the oldest forms of furniture. It is a rectangular structure with four walls and a liftable lid, for storage. Shed - A shed is generally a modest structure, usually constructed of wood in a back garden or on an allotment, used for storage and as a workshop and very often as a retreat in which to relax and pursue hobbies, especially gardening and light engineering. Sheds are often highly individual and personalized, and the larger shed will be made comfortable by adapting worn out furniture.
